Corporate Tax Rate Reduction

A cornerstone of the Trump Tax Bill was the substantial reduction in the corporate tax rate. This change aims to stimulate business investment, job creation, and economic growth. However, the long-term economic effects are subject to ongoing debate.

  • The New Corporate Tax Rate: The proposed reduction in the corporate tax rate (e.g., from 35% to 21%) was a central feature of the bill. This lower rate aimed to enhance the competitiveness of American businesses on the global stage.

  • Potential Effects on Business Investment and Expansion: Proponents argued that the lower tax rate would incentivize businesses to invest more in their operations, leading to expansion, modernization, and increased job creation.

  • Predicted Impact on Job Creation and Wages: A lower corporate tax rate could theoretically translate to increased hiring and higher wages. However, the extent to which this prediction materializes depends on several factors, including business decisions and the overall economic climate.

  • Analysis of Competitiveness with Other Countries: The reduction aimed to make American businesses more competitive globally by aligning the US corporate tax rate with those of other developed nations. This increased competitiveness could attract foreign investment and boost domestic economic activity.
